Transaction 158a1c78495e8f8e5623a0ad16178b3bacdf6343cc7572dde92e59c87c75937e

1 Input
2 Outputs
  • 158a1c78495e8f8e5623a0ad16178b3bacdf6343cc7572dde92e59c87c75937e:0
  • value  1559236
    address  3KUiDxpmAY2Zr6ifeDq1tgtR2FQN72bUUL
  • 158a1c78495e8f8e5623a0ad16178b3bacdf6343cc7572dde92e59c87c75937e:1
  • value  40875856
    address  12W4UShG4hbD2Q4Ch41UksTqb6c2Q3Cn14